I've done some nutrition activities with my students. I was surprised when I found out they didn't even know how foods were categorized (fruits vs veggies vs meat, etc.). Could you work from the food pyramid,
and maybe do a day for each portion of the pyramid? You could read books (Look for Lois Ehlert's works--so good!), taste, graph, sort, and pattern. I also had a fun idea to cut out pictures from grocery store ads, paste them on sentence strips, and put them in a 3-ring binder. You could have the kids classify them by food type, or you could. I wanted to turn it into a shopping
center--kids could buy foods from different portions of the pyramid--maybe put prices under each food and buy with pennies? Anyway, food! Yay! Do lots of reading and cooking, you'll be good! Have fun!
